    Background

    An oil well commonly produces the crude consisting of gas,oil, water, and contaminants. A gas oil separation process(GOSP) handles the crude from the well and separates oil,gas, water, and contaminants. The processed oil and gas canthen be sent to oil refineries and gas processing plants,

    respectively.

    For field development research and assessment, a numberof process scenarios must be quickly generated and assignedwith different probabilities. The Aspen HYSYS and

    Conceptual Design Builder lets you quickly generate thenecessary iterated, individual scenarios necessary for fielddevelopment research and assessment.

    Problem Statement

    An oil field produces the crude with the followingspecifications that is processed in a gas oil separationplant:

    - Gas/Oil Ratio (GOR): 200

    - Water/Oil Ratio (WOR): 0.02- Production Rate: 2000 barrels/day

    Using Aspen HYSYS and the Conceptual Design Builder,determine the oil, gas, and water production rate fromthis process.
